What Is a Tip (Gratuity)?
A tip, or gratuity, is a sum of money given to service workers as a token of appreciation for their service. It is typically calculated as a percentage of the total bill. In this case, we will be calculating 21% of an $82 bill to determine the appropriate tip amount.
How to Tip?
When determining how much to tip, consider the level of service you received. A common practice is to tip between 15% and 20% for satisfactory service, with 21% being a generous option for exceptional service. Simply multiply the bill amount by the percentage to find the total tip.

How do I calculate a 21% tip on an $82 bill?
To calculate a 21% tip on an $82 bill, multiply 82 by 0.21, which equals $17.22.

Do I tip on the total amount before or after taxes?
Tipping is usually calculated on the total amount before taxes, but some people choose to tip on the total after taxes for better service recognition.
